在工作表中实现适合页面选项
介绍
使用电子表格时,最常见的问题之一是如何确保您的数据在打印或共享时看起来很棒。您希望您的同事、客户或学生能够轻松阅读您的数据,而无需滚动浏览无数页面。幸运的是,Aspose.Cells for .NET 提供了一种简单的方法,即使用“适合页面”选项使您的电子表格可以打印。在本指南中,我们将探讨如何在 Excel 工作簿中轻松实现此功能。
先决条件
在深入研究代码之前,您应该做好以下几件事以确保顺利完成本教程:
- Visual Studio:首先,您需要一个可以编写 .NET 代码的 IDE。Visual Studio 社区版是免费的,是一个不错的选择。
- Aspose.Cells for .NET:您需要在项目中安装 Aspose.Cells 库。您可以通过 NuGet 包管理器轻松获取它。只需搜索“Aspose.Cells”并安装它即可。有关更多详细信息,您可以查看文档.
- C# 基础知识:虽然我会逐步解释所有内容,但拥有一些 C# 基础知识将会很有帮助。
- 文件的目录:您还需要一个目录来保存修改后的 Excel 文件。提前计划,这样您就知道工作完成后该在哪里查找。 一旦一切准备就绪,我们就开始吧!
导入包
现在,让我们讨论如何导入必要的包。在 C# 中,您需要包含特定的命名空间才能利用 Aspose.Cells 提供的功能。操作方法如下:
创建新的 C# 文件
打开 Visual Studio,创建一个新的控制台项目,并添加一个新的 C# 文件。您可以将此文件命名为FitToPageExample.cs
.
导入 Aspose.Cells 命名空间
在文件顶部,您需要导入 Aspose.Cells 命名空间,该命名空间使您可以访问工作簿和工作表类。添加以下代码行:
using System.IO;
using Aspose.Cells;
using System;
就这样!您已准备好开始编码了。 让我们将实施过程分解为简单易懂的步骤。我们将介绍在工作表中设置“适合页面”选项所需执行的每个操作。
步骤 1:定义文档目录的路径
在开始处理任何内容之前,您需要确定文件的保存位置。
string dataDir = "Your Document Directory";
代替"Your Document Directory"
与您想要存储修改后的 Excel 文件的路径。
步骤 2:实例化工作簿对象
接下来,您需要创建 Workbook 类的一个实例。该类代表您的 Excel 文件。
Workbook workbook = new Workbook();
现在,您已经创建了一个我们可以操作的空工作簿。
步骤 3:访问第一个工作表
每个工作簿至少包含一个工作表。让我们访问第一个工作表。
Worksheet worksheet = workbook.Worksheets[0];
在这里,我们说:“给我第一张纸,这样我就可以处理它了。”很简单,对吧?
步骤 4:设置适合页面高度
接下来,您要控制工作表在打印时的适合程度。首先指定工作表的高度:
worksheet.PageSetup.FitToPagesTall = 1;
这意味着您的整个工作表内容将缩小到适合一页打印的高度。
步骤 5:设置适合页面宽度
类似地,您可以设置工作表的页宽:
worksheet.PageSetup.FitToPagesWide = 1;
现在,您的 Excel 内容也将适合一页打印页面的宽度。
步骤 6:保存工作簿
完成更改后,就可以保存工作簿了:
workbook.Save(dataDir + "FitToPagesOptions_out.xls");
在这里,您将在指定的目录中保存名为“FitToPagesOptions_out.xls”的文件。
结论
就这样!您已成功使用 Aspose.Cells for .NET 在 Excel 工作表中实现了“适合页面”选项。此功能可以显著提高电子表格的可读性,确保打印时不会丢失或切断重要数据。无论您处理的是报告、发票还是任何计划共享的文档,这款精巧的工具都是您工具包中不可或缺的工具。
常见问题解答
什么是 Aspose.Cells for .NET?
Aspose.Cells 是一个用于处理 Excel 文件操作的 .NET 库,使您能够以编程方式创建、修改和转换 Excel 文件。
Aspose.Cells 有免费试用版吗?
是的!您可以访问免费试用图书馆。
在哪里可以找到该文档?
这文档提供如何有效使用图书馆的全面指导。
我可以购买 Aspose.Cells 的永久许可证吗?
当然!您可以找到购买选项这里.
如果在使用 Aspose.Cells 时遇到问题,该怎么办?
如果你需要帮助,你可以在 Aspose 上发布你的疑问支持论坛.